What Are Barn Finds in Forza Horizon 5?

Barn finds are a staple feature in the Forza Horizon series, representing forgotten classics waiting to be discovered. In Forza Horizon 5, the system works through a series of rumors that lead you to search specific areas of the map for hidden barns.

Each barn contains a unique vehicle that, once found, will be restored over a period of real-world time (usually several hours). After restoration, these cars join your garage as fully functional vehicles you can drive, modify, or add to your collection.

Unlike Forza Horizon 4, which tied some barn finds to specific seasons, FH5 makes all barn finds available regardless of the current season – making completion more straightforward.

How Barn Find Rumors Work

Barn find rumors unlock through various methods:

  1. Story Progression – Some unlock naturally as you progress through the campaign
  2. Expedition Completion – Several are tied to specific expedition missions
  3. House Purchases – At least one requires buying a player house
  4. Random Unlocks – Some appear randomly as you play

When a rumor becomes available, you‘ll hear about it on the radio, and a large pink circle will appear on your map. The barn is somewhere within this search area, but you‘ll need to explore to pinpoint its exact location.

Restoration Process Explained

Once you discover a barn find, you can‘t drive it immediately. The vehicle enters a restoration process:

  1. Initial Discovery: You find the barn and claim the vehicle
  2. Transport Phase: The car is transported to your garage (instantaneous)
  3. Restoration Period: A real-time waiting period (varies per vehicle)
  4. Completion Notification: You receive a message when restoration is complete
  5. Vehicle Delivery: The car is added to your garage, ready to drive

The restoration waiting period typically ranges from 45 minutes to 5 hours, depending on the vehicle‘s rarity and condition. This mechanic simulates the real-world time and effort needed to restore classic vehicles.

How To Search for Barn Finds Effectively

Finding barns efficiently requires strategy. Here are proven techniques to make your barn hunting more successful:

Use Drone Mode

The drone view allows you to scout large areas quickly without physically driving to each location. This is particularly useful in dense jungle or mountainous areas where visibility is limited.

Look for Telltale Signs

Barns typically have:

  • Small dirt paths leading to them
  • Clearings in forest areas
  • Distinctive rooftops visible from a distance
  • Proximity to other structures

Search Strategic Locations

Barns are often found:

  • Near the edges of the search area
  • In locations that would realistically house a farm building
  • Away from main roads but accessible by vehicle
  • In somewhat flat terrain

Use Fast Travel Strategically

If you own the Buenas Vistas house (which grants free fast travel), you can quickly jump between points to search different sections of a rumor area.

Vehicle Selection Matters

Choose the right vehicle for your search:

  • Off-road vehicles are essential for jungle and mountain areas
  • Fast cars help cover ground quickly in open areas
  • Raised suspension helps navigate rough terrain without getting stuck

Time of Day Considerations

Some barns are easier to spot at specific times:

  • Daytime provides better visibility in dense vegetation
  • Dawn/dusk creates shadows that can highlight structures
  • Night allows you to spot areas where a building might interrupt natural darkness patterns

Complete Guide to All 14 Barn Find Locations

Here‘s the definitive guide to every barn find in Forza Horizon 5, including exact locations, unlock requirements, and the vehicles you‘ll discover.

Barn Find #1: 1970 GMC Jimmy

Unlock Requirement: Complete the Horizon Apex Tulum Expedition

Location: Between Atlantes De Tula and Cascades De Agua Azul, follow a small overgrown path through dense vegetation to find this barn.

About the Car: The GMC Jimmy is a classic American SUV, perfect for off-road exploration in Mexico. This two-door 4×4 comes with a powerful V8 engine and represents the golden age of American utility vehicles.

Restoration Time: Appro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 310 HP
  • Stock Weight: 3,851 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 7.2 seconds
  • Top Speed: 118 MPH
  • Drivetrain: 4WD

Barn Find #2: 1991 Jaguar Sport XJR-15

Unlock Requirement: Complete the Jungle Expedition (Horizon Wilds Outpost)

Location: To the left side of the runway strip at Aerodromo En La Selva. The barn is partially concealed by vegetation.

About the Car: One of only 53 ever made, the Jaguar XJR-15 is a rare mid-engine sports car developed from Jaguar‘s Le Mans racing program. With a 6.0-liter V12 engine producing 450 horsepower, this is one of the most valuable barn finds in the game.

Restoration Time: Approximately 3 hours

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 450 HP
  • Stock Weight: 2,315 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 3.9 seconds
  • Top Speed: 191 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#3: 1967 Ford Racing Escort MK 1

Unlock Requirement: Complete the Baja Expedition

Location: Near the volcano. During the expedition, you‘ll need to collect water samples which triggers the barn find rumor.

About the Car: This rally icon represents Ford‘s dominance in European motorsport during the late 1960s. The lightweight chassis and tuned engine make it an excellent choice for dirt racing events.

Restoration Time: Approximately 2 hours

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 150 HP
  • Stock Weight: 1,808 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 7.3 seconds
  • Top Speed: 117 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#4: 1953 Chevrolet Corvette

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: East of Los Jardines, near the highway. Look for the barn at the edge of the purple search area marker.

About the Car: The first-generation Corvette is American automotive royalty. This 1953 model was among the first 300 Corvettes ever produced, making it historically significant. With its distinctive fiberglass body and inline-six engine, it‘s quite different from later V8 Corvettes.

Restoration Time: Approximately 2 hours and 15 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 150 HP
  • Stock Weight: 2,980 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 11.0 seconds
  • Top Speed: 107 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#5: 1968 Renault 4L Export

Unlock Requirement: Purchase La Cabana player house (150,000 Credits)

Location: In the desert area with light vegetation. Look near the speed trap sign on your map.

About the Car: This humble French economy car was designed as Renault‘s answer to the Citroën 2CV. While not powerful, the 4L‘s character and charm make it a fun addition to any collection. Over 8 million were produced during its 31-year production run.

Restoration Time: Approximately 45 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 34 HP
  • Stock Weight: 1,432 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 21.0 seconds
  • Top Speed: 72 MPH
  • Drivetrain: FWD

Barn Find #6: 1956 Ford F-100

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: In Tierra Rospera near the Las Curvas sign. Look for a blue house – the barn is adjacent to it.

About the Car: The F-100 pickup represents American work ethic and utility. This third-generation model features the distinctive "big window" cab design and can be modified into everything from a period-correct work truck to a modern hot rod.

Restoration Time: Appro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 173 HP
  • Stock Weight: 3,558 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 12.1 seconds
  • Top Speed: 98 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#7: 1989 Ferrari F40 Competizione

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: Along the coast of Rivera Maya. You‘ll need to cross a small water body to reach the barn.

About the Car: Arguably the most valuable barn find, the F40 Competizione is an ultra-rare racing version of Ferrari‘s iconic supercar. With a twin-turbocharged V8 producing over 700 horsepower in a lightweight body, this is one of the most thrilling cars in the game. Interestingly, this example wears a light blue paint scheme rather than the traditional Ferrari red.

Restoration Time: Approximately 4 hours

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 700 HP
  • Stock Weight: 2,475 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 3.1 seconds
  • Top Speed: 228 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#8: 1973 BMW 2002 Turbo

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: Near the Fuera Del Camino Trail Event sign on Guanajuato Highway 9. Follow the small pathway leading to an open area with the barn.

About the Car: The BMW 2002 Turbo was Germany‘s first turbocharged production car and laid the foundation for BMW‘s performance heritage. With its boxy design, iconic graphics, and engaging handling, it‘s a favorite among classic car enthusiasts.

Restoration Time: Appro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 170 HP
  • Stock Weight: 2,395 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 6.9 seconds
  • Top Speed: 132 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#9: 1962 Ferrari 250 GTO

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: Near Los Jardines on Highway 11, in a grassy area.

About the Car: The 250 GTO is arguably the most valuable car in the world, with real examples selling for over $70 million at auction. Only 36 were ever made, and this barn find lets you experience Ferrari‘s legendary racing machine from the early 1960s. This example is finished in classic Ferrari red.

Restoration Time: Approximately 5 hours

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 300 HP
  • Stock Weight: 2,094 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 5.4 seconds
  • Top Speed: 174 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#10: 1973 Porsche 911 Carrera RS

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: Near Colimas Aridas by the speed trap. Look for light yellow grassland with a few buildings – the barn is among them.

About the Car: The Carrera RS is considered the purest expression of Porsche‘s air-cooled 911 philosophy. This lightened, more powerful version of the standard 911 became the foundation for Porsche‘s racing success and remains highly sought after by collectors.

Restoration Time: Approximately 2 hours and 30 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 210 HP
  • Stock Weight: 2,150 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 5.5 seconds
  • Top Speed: 152 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#11: 1993 Toyota #1 T100 Baja Truck

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: In the Baja California region. Look for two brown circular markings with light-colored borders on the map. The barn is in a large cactus field.

About the Car: This purpose-built racing truck competed in the brutal Baja 1000 desert race. With massive suspension travel, a powerful engine, and incredible off-road capability, the T100 Baja Truck is perfect for conquering the roughest terrain in Forza Horizon 5.

Restoration Time: Approximately 2 hours

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 550 HP
  • Stock Weight: 3,300 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 4.0 seconds
  • Top Speed: 135 MPH
  • Drivetrain: 4WD

Barn Find #12: 1968 Ford Mustang GT 2+2 Fastback

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: Drive north from Hotel Mirador Balderama past the stunt sign. The barn is visible from the road.

About the Car: This is the legendary "Bullitt" Mustang, made famous by Steve McQueen in the 1968 film. The fastback body style and powerful V8 engine created one of the most iconic muscle cars of all time. Perfect for recreating the famous San Francisco chase scene.

Restoration Time: Approximately 2 hours

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 325 HP
  • Stock Weight: 3,368 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 6.3 seconds
  • Top Speed: 131 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#13: 1968 Dodge Dart Hemi Super Stock

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: In Granjas De Tapalpa region. On the map, look directly below the final letters of "Teotihuacan" to find its location.

About the Car: The Dart Hemi Super Stock was a factory-built drag racing special. With a massive Hemi V8 crammed into the lightweight Dart body, these cars were essentially street-legal race cars designed to dominate quarter-mile competition.

Restoration Time: Appro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 425 HP
  • Stock Weight: 3,175 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 4.7 seconds
  • Top Speed: 140 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D

Barn Find #14: 1999 Dodge Viper GTS ACR

Unlock Requirement: Random unlock during gameplay

Location: In Gran Pantano. Drive to the road below the name on the map, then look for a small area with trees surrounded by rocks. Crash through and continue straight until you see a building.

About the Car: The Viper GTS ACR (American Club Racing) represents the pinnacle of first-generation Viper performance. With its massive 8.0-liter V10 engine and track-focused suspension, it‘s one of the most raw and exciting American sports cars ever made.

Restoration Time: Approximately 2 hours and 15 minutes

Performance Stats:

  • Stock Power: 460 HP
  • Stock Weight: 3,294 lbs
  • 0-60 MPH: 4.0 seconds
  • Top Speed: 185 MPH
  • Drivetrain: RWD
